For those who enjoy the journey as much as the destination, this book is organized into chapters that range from day trips to weeklong excursions. Exploring Florida's less traveled regions, this guide has something of interest for everyone--the historian, the naturalist, the scientist, the mystic, the beach-lover, the gourmand, and the child in all of us. Traveler's tips provide expert insight into the state's true must-sees. Backroads & Byways of Florida is the shortest route a visitor can take to exploring like a native and for natives to delve more deeply into the history and magic of their home state.

About the author

Zain Deane is an award-winning fiction writer and the author of Explorer's Guide Mexico's Aztec & Maya Empires; Explorer's Guide San Juan, Vieques & Culebra; Explorer's Guide Mexico City; Puebla & Cuernavaca; and Backroads & Byways of Florida. Deane lives in Fort Lauderdale, FL.
